$180,000 Salary After Taxes in Tennessee
A $180,000 annual salary in Tennessee results in approximately $134,198 take-home pay after Federal Income Tax, FICA (SS + Medicare). That works out to roughly $11,183 per month or $65 per hour.
Take-home in Tennessee
$134,198
out of $180,000 gross ยท Effective tax: 25.4%

About Tennessee Taxes
Tennessee eliminated its Hall Tax on investment income in 2021, making it fully income-tax-free on wages and salaries. Tennessee relies on a high sales tax to fund state government. The state's lack of income tax has made Nashville and other cities popular destinations.
